13.06.2024fromJon Stroud
Having used Pirelli Scorpions as a winter tyre before, I've always been extremely happy with their performance. For a soft compound tyre the wear rate on them is surprisingly good - I usually get a good 3+ winters on them swapping them in in December and out again round about March. They get a lot of driving on pretty poor country roads as well as longer motorway runs and, when the weather gets bad, inspire a great deal of confidence. Grip on the snow is exceptional. They are a little noisier than the Pirelli P-Zeros that I run the rest of the year but that's to be expected - generally you only notice that when switching back to the summer tyres!

14.06.2021fromy2kdisease
Car had 20" 245/35r20 runflats in front and 275/30r20 runflats (all MOE) for RWD w213 luxury saloon. The car came with these factory fitted MOE runflat tyres. I've Replaced these tyres and wheels at 10600km. I've driven 8600km of that mileage. The tyres wore like rubber bands on the 20" wheels. Steering as a result is very precise in both wet and dry. Front 245/30s have sound deadening foam and overall tyre noise is quiet in the cabin (but just wee bit louder than the 18" PS4 tyres I replaced them with). Ride comfort is 8/10 on highways due to air suspension. On chip seal, speed humps, potholed roads ride comfort is 5/10 - there is very abrupt jarring transmitted to cabin due to tyre profile and rims. Wet grip in cold (5'C) and damp country highways was 7/10 at 110km/h speeds - there was some slip noticeable. Dry grip was 8/10 most of the time but with occasional rear traction slips at highway speeds in curves. This combination of tyres and rims is quite poor for a luxury sedan and compliant rides.

21.05.2019fromJane
I bought these as they rated well performing across the board. Not top in anything but above everything that was top in at least one area. The wet grip and braking is fantastic. Performed well throughout the cold months but we had no snow this year to test them. On warm dry roads the compound or pattern does not allow for an aggressive driving style but I never intended to keep them on in the summer so this was irrelevant to me. They make a noise like driving through standing water in the wet which is strange at first but I wouldn't say generally they were any noisier than my Eagle asymmetric 2 that they replaced. Did everything I expected from them and will be re fitting them come the winter.
